import { inspect, InspectOptions } from "util";
import V2 from "../V2";
import { ApiResponse } from "../../../base/ApiResponse";
export declare class AccountReport {
/**
* The call deliverability score measures the network effectiveness in delivering calls by scoring calls reach the intended recipient. The score is a value between 0 and 100, where 100 indicates that all calls were successfully delivered.
*/
"callDeliverabilityScore"?: number;
/**
* The call answer score measures customers behavior to the delivered calls. The score is a value between 0 and 100, where 100 indicates that all calls were successfully answered.
*/
"callAnswerScore"?: number;
/**
* Total number of calls made during the report period.
*/
"totalCalls"?: number;
"callDirection"?: AccountReportCallDirection;
"callState"?: AccountReportCallState;
"callType"?: AccountReportCallType;
/**
* Average length of call in seconds.
*/
"aloc"?: number;
/**
* Number of calls made in each Twilio Edge location. Refer to [Public Edge Locations](https://www.twilio.com/docs/global-infrastructure/edge-locations#public-edge-locations) for more detail.
*/
"twilioEdgeLocation"?: {
[key: string]: number;
};
/**
* Number of calls originating from each country (ISO alpha-2).
*/
"callerCountryCode"?: {
[key: string]: number;
};
/**
* Number of calls terminating in each country (ISO alpha-2).
*/
"calleeCountryCode"?: {
[key: string]: number;
};
/**
* Average queue time in milliseconds.
*/
"averageQueueTimeMs"?: number;
/**
* Percentage of silent calls.
*/
"silentCallsPercentage"?: number;
"networkIssues"?: AccountReportNetworkIssues;
"kYT"?: AccountReportKYT;
"answeringMachineDetection"?: AccountReportAnsweringMachineDetection;
constructor(payload: any);
}

/**
* Know Your Traffic (KYT) metrics focused on outbound carrier performance and trust signals for the report period.
*/
export declare class AccountReportKYT {
"outboundCarrierCalling"?: AccountReportKYTOutboundCarrierCalling;
constructor(payload: any);
}
/**
* KYT metrics for outbound carrier calling.
*/
export declare class AccountReportKYTOutboundCarrierCalling {
/**
* Number of unique PSTN calling numbers to non-Twilio numbers during the report period.
*/
"uniqueCallingNumbers"?: number;
/**
* Number of unique non-Twilio PSTN called numbers during the report period.
*/
"uniqueCalledNumbers"?: number;
/**
* Percentage of blocked calls by carrier per country.
*/
"blockedCallsByCarrier"?: Array<CountyCarrierValue>;
/**
* Percentage of completed outbound calls under 10 seconds (PSTN Short call tags); More than 15% is typically low trust measured.
*/
"shortDurationCallsPercentage"?: number;
/**
* Percentage of long duration calls ( >= 60 seconds)
*/
"longDurationCallsPercentage"?: number;
/**
* Percentage of completed outbound calls to unassigned or unallocated phone numbers.
*/
"potentialRobocallsPercentage"?: number;
"brandedCalling"?: BrandedCalling;
"voiceIntegrity"?: VoiceIntegrity;
"stirShaken"?: StirShaken;
constructor(payload: any);
}
